Takashi Ono is a scholar working on Molecular Biology, Oncology and Surgery. According to data from OpenAlex, Takashi Ono has authored 14 papers receiving a total of 369 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 4 papers in Oncology and 2 papers in Surgery. Recurrent topics in Takashi Ono’s work include Pluripotent Stem Cells Research (4 papers), Cancer-related Molecular Pathways (3 papers) and CRISPR and Genetic Engineering (2 papers). Takashi Ono is often cited by papers focused on Pluripotent Stem Cells Research (4 papers), Cancer-related Molecular Pathways (3 papers) and CRISPR and Genetic Engineering (2 papers). Takashi Ono collaborates with scholars based in Japan and United States. Takashi Ono's co-authors include Sanae M.M. Iguchi‐Ariga, Hirotake Kitaura, Hiroyoshi Ariga, Toshiki Tsurimoto, Hiroshi Yoshikawa, Takehide Murata, Hideyo Ugai, Kazunari K. Yokoyama, Yoshihito Ishida and Masayoshi Uehata and has published in prestigious journals such as Journal of Biological Chemistry, PLoS ONE and Japanese Journal of Applied Physics.
